9The THE CHURCH IS GOD’S FLOCK blend as a conceptual instrument in early church liturgy and theology

In this chapter I examine three subcategories of the CGF blend that are frequently used in patristic baptismal theology, doctrinal disputes on the unity of the church, and soteriology with elements of Christology. They share several structural elements: each is a single scope network (occasionally a double scope network); shepherding imagery in their source input spaces is taken most often from the Bible; each is the conceptual basis for significant theological ideas that play a central role in Christian doctrine, such as baptismal initiation and its spiritual consequences, the unity of the church, and Christ’s incarnation as a part of God’s plan for saving fallen humanity.
